<p>Same here. I can't see, hear nor smell anything apart from what is really there.<p>I can 'imagine' in great detail, have a good visual/ auditory memory, but there is no real picture or sound. It is black / silent. I never forget a face just can't picture them.<p>I found out about this via an article posted here when I was 45 years old, now 4 years ago.<p>It never felt and does feel like a disability in any way.<p>Dreams in contrast are a full sensory experience for me, so the route back from memory to senses is there, only it is blocked when I am awake.</p>

<p>Technically you can do a transaction by holding a mobile EMV payment terminal to someone's card without them knowing (this only works for physical cards, mobile phones need to be unlocked first).<p>The protection is the fact you just can't get a mobile payment terminal without a whole "know your customer" due diligence process, so the fraud traces directly to the ultimate beneficial owner of the company to which the payment acceptance contract of the payment terminal was provided.<p>This is the reason this fraud is non-existent in Europe, where tap to pay is already used for years.</p>

<p>I use those (DreamLite)and they are getting more and more common in the Netherlands.
 Every contact lens specialist shop sells them. They around EUR 500 a year including cleaning fluids and check-ups.<p>Be sure to get checks regularly and practice extra good eye hygiene, because they do have a higher risk of infections, also eye doctors do not recommend them.<p>Biggest drawback I experience are coronas around bright lights at night, but you do get used to them. I can conformably drive a car at night, because the sight is sharp. The extend also varies from person to person.<p>If you can tolerate the lenses with your eyes open, you can also already wear them in the evening if you need perfect sight in low light.<p>On topic: you cannot permanently reverse myopia, but it gets better when you get older for some people.<p>Ortho-K lenses can however be used by children to stop myopia from getting worse.</p>
